khdaniel Posted October 10, 2012 Report Share Posted October 10, 2012 I have a 2001 Deville and clean clear water is trickeling from under the dash down the front left corner of the passenger side floor board carpet. It is not antifreeze. I suspect it is condensation from the Air conditioning system as it seems to happen when the A/C is running. I can't determine where it's coming from or how to stop it. If anyone can suggest a cause and solution for this problem, many thanks in advance. Thanks!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Texas Jim Posted October 10, 2012 Report Share Posted October 10, 2012 Look for the drain for the ac... It is probably stopped up. It should be a little rubber hose, right at the bottom of the firewall on the passengers side. Use a stiff wire or real small screwdriver to clear it out. DO NOT have your face right under it when you clear it...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
